    Sink, shower, toilet
    My bathroom sink has been draining very slowly for a couple weeks. Drano has not helped. The suddenly yesterday, my shower is doing the same thing and my toilet water was low. When the shower water went down the toilet water went back to normal. This morning once again the shower drained slowly and the toilet clogged.
  • Mar 23, 2015, 07:55 AM
    ma0641
    Pretty typical of a clogged main drain line. You will most likely need someone to auger out the main line. Have them check the vents too.
